During the 2020-2021 academic year, Utah Valley University handed out 37 bachelor's degrees in computer engineering. This is an increase of 6% over the previous year when 35 degrees were handed out.

How Much Do CE Graduates from UVU Make?

$78,678 Bachelor's Median Salary

Salary of CE Graduates with a Bachelor's Degree

CE majors who earn their bachelor's degree from UVU go on to jobs where they make a median salary of $78,678 a year. This is great news for graduates of the program, since this figure is higher than the national average of $70,001 for all ce bachelor's degree recipients.

How Much Student Debt Do CE Graduates from UVU Have?

$14,563 Bachelor's Median Debt

Student Debt of CE Graduates with a Bachelor's Degree

While getting their bachelor's degree at UVU, ce students borrow a median amount of $14,563 in student loans. This is not too bad considering that the median debt load of all ce bachelor's degree recipients across the country is $24,500.

CE Student Diversity at UVU

Take a look at the following statistics related to the make-up of the ce majors at Utah Valley University.

UVU Computer Engineering Bachelor’s Program

Of the 37 students who earned a bachelor's degree in Computer Engineering from UVU in 2020-2021, 84% were men and 16% were women.

The majority of the students with this major are white. About 81% of 2021 graduates were in this category.
